Field Characters
Grows in colonies from creeping, 2-3 mm thick, orange colored rhizomes, three to six bracts, with distinctive white spots, surround the flowers.
Natural History
A common plant in ditches and wet places throughout Louisiana and east Texas.
Habitat
Damp sandy soil.
